#1f8348 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#1f8348 is composed of 12.2% red, 51.4% green and 28.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 76.3% cyan, 0% magenta, 45% yellow and 48.6% black. It has a hue angle of 144.6 degrees, a saturation of 61.7% and a lightness of 31.8%. #1f8348 color hex could be obtained by blending #3eff90 with #000700. Closest websafe color is: #339933.

Shades and Tints of #1f8348
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010402 is the darkest color, while #f3fcf7 is the lightest one.

Tones of #1f8348
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#515151 is the less saturated color, while #069c44 is the most saturated one.
